Why should damaged wiring be repaired properly?

Damaged wiring must be repaired properly to keep the electrical system safe and reliable. The wiring harness carries power and signals to many critical functions—lights, sensors, engine and transmission controls, airbags, and safety systems. When wiring is damaged, insulation can fail, leading to short circuits, intermittent connections, or arcing, which can cause electrical fires or sudden system failures. A proper repair involves carefully assessing the damage, replacing harmed sections or the entire harness as needed, using correct gauge wires, proper connectors, and durable seals, and routing and securing the harness to prevent chafing or water intrusion. This ensures predictable electrical performance and reduces the risk of unexpected problems.

Increasing top speed, improving fuel economy, or reducing engine vibrations aren’t direct outcomes of wiring repair; those qualities come from other areas like mechanical tuning, fuel management, and vibration isolation.
